Speccy Portable is a simple system analyzer that displays detailed information about the configuration and technical features of your computer.Īdded Windows 8 beta support.- Rearchitecting data loading order.- Improved exception handling for CPU and GFX sections.- Improved detection of Admin Shares.- Improved bug data collection and reporting.- Fixed minor GUI issues.
